Annual Citroen Club of North America Meet at Carlisle, PA

February 2, 2010 by Denis · Leave a Comment 

Image by AF-Photography via Flickr The annual “Carlisle Meet” will take place May 21 to 23, 2010 in conjunction with the Carlisle Import Show at the Carlisle Fairgrounds, Carlisle, PA. We would like to invite ALL Citroen owners and club members to attend this year’s show, meeting, and banquet. The flea market and “import fun field” show area [...]
